About Vale Perkins, Quebec

Vale Perkins is a hamlet in Potton; Memphrémagog, Quebec,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Vale Perkins is located at 45.0881°N, 72.3047°W.

Vale Perkins rests where the land leans toward the deep, cool expanse of Lac Memphrémagog, cradled beneath the watchful silhouette of the Colline du Porc-Épic. It lies 23.2 km south-south-west of Magog, QC (from Magog, QC: bearing 212°T), and is situated 8.1 km east-north-east of Mansonville.
